The Pistons will close off their draft with a young prospect/insurance big...

Image

Ian Mahinmi!

He's a promising young PF/C who has developed a lot in France, on the Spurs and on their D-League affiliate. He has great rebounding and shotblocking instincts. The main criticism is his weight and strength. This offseason he's supposedly bulked up a lot and we expect this to continue. He won't get much playing time but will be used as insurance for our other bigs.
